Philippe Coutinho signs new Liverpool deal

Liverpool's Brazilian playmaker Philippe Coutinho signs a new contract at Anfield, reportedly until the summer of 2020.

Liverpool playmaker Philippe Coutinho has signed a new contract at Anfield.

The 22-year-old, who arrived on Merseyside from Inter Milan two years ago, is believed to have agreed to terms until the summer of 2020.

"I'm really happy. It's a dream come true playing for this great club and being part of this squad," he told the club's official website.

"Today I've committed my future to the club and for this I'm feeling very pleased. This club is great and the fans have always supported me, so I've been eager to sign this new deal since conversations started. Today is a very happy day."

Manager Brendan Rodgers added: "I'm delighted that Philippe has committed his long-term future to us. He is clearly going to be a big part of our story in the years to come.

"The most exciting thing isn't just how good he is now, it's the further improvement he can make in his game. In terms of potential, he can still become even better."

To date, Coutinho has scored 10 goals during his 81 appearances for the Reds.
